We have a 75 Gallon Tank with a Dog face Puffer, Snowflake Eel, and a Koran. (3 days new) PH-8.2, Nitrite-0, Ammonia-0, Nitrate-0. Water Changes 25% once a month. Filtration- 3 power heads, 1 bio wheel, 1-Canister for 150G Tank. The tank has been running for about a year, fish are 2-months new, Koran is 3 days new. (We just bought a new canister filter about 2 weeks ago)
Background: Our tank recycled, so we brought the DFP to our local fish store and they babysat for about a week. When our tank was ready we picked up our Puffer, and also purchased a Koran. (the eel made it thru the recycle so he stayed with us) It's been three days and the Koran and Eel are fine, but today the puffer showed all of the symptoms listed below.
Our puffer has lost his brown color on 3/4 of his body and its being replaced with a white/cream/light grey solid color and he also has white lesion's all over his back. (larger than ich) These symptoms only appeared today, and the Puffer is at the bottom of the tank, breathing heavy, tail is curled. He's not looking good at all!!
I immediately added copper to the tank, thinking it was velvet ich, but now these white lesion's have appeared. Any advice would be helpful! We need to save our little guy.
